Class SearchMatch.DefaultBuilder
java.lang.Object
org.springframework.shell.support.search.SearchMatch.DefaultBuilder
- All Implemented Interfaces:
SearchMatch.Builder
- Enclosing interface:
- SearchMatch
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build()Build instance of aSearchMatch.caseSensitive(boolean caseSensitive) Set a flag forcaseSensitive.forward(boolean forward) Set a flag forforward.normalize(boolean normalize) Set a flag fornormalize.
-
Constructor Details
-
DefaultBuilder
public DefaultBuilder()
-
-
Method Details
-
caseSensitive
Description copied from interface:SearchMatch.BuilderSet a flag forcaseSensitive.- Specified by:
caseSensitivein interfaceSearchMatch.Builder- Parameters:
caseSensitive- the caseSensitive- Returns:
- builder for chaining
-
normalize
Description copied from interface:SearchMatch.BuilderSet a flag fornormalize.- Specified by:
normalizein interfaceSearchMatch.Builder- Parameters:
normalize- the normalize- Returns:
- builder for chaining
-
forward
Description copied from interface:SearchMatch.BuilderSet a flag forforward.- Specified by:
forwardin interfaceSearchMatch.Builder- Parameters:
forward- the forward- Returns:
- builder for chaining
-
build
Description copied from interface:SearchMatch.BuilderBuild instance of aSearchMatch.- Specified by:
buildin interfaceSearchMatch.Builder- Returns:
- a build instance of
SearchMatch
-